
Field Service Technician

• Install, test, and commission new centrifuge equipment at client locations.
• Execute scheduled preventive maintenance activities on centrifuge equipment.
• Identify and troubleshoot equipment malfunctions and failures.
• Implement field upgrades and modifications to current equipment.
• Deliver training to clients on the operation, maintenance, and troubleshooting of centrifuge equipment.
• Keep precise records of service activities and generate comprehensive reports.
• Respond swiftly to customer service requests and inquiries.
• Suggest replacement and/or spare parts for acquisition.
• Follow safety protocols and guidelines while performing work.
• High school diploma with over 5 years of pertinent experience.
• Associate degree or technical certification in electro-mechanical technology (or a related field), along with 3+ years of relevant experience.
• Strong technical skills with experience in troubleshooting and repairing electrical, mechanical, pneumatic, and control systems.
• Ability to read and comprehend technical documents (e.g., engineering drawings, manuals, BOMs, etc.).
• Exceptional interpersonal and communication abilities.
•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
• Capability to write clear service reports and business correspondence.
•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Teams, Outlook).
• Meticulous attention to detail and precision.
• Willingness to travel extensively to client locations.
• Valid driver's license with a clean driving record.
• A valid passport (or the ability to obtain one).
• Relevant certifications such as Certified Electronics Technician (CET) are advantageous.
• English is the primary language; multilingual abilities are a plus.
